Lines Matching refs:bfa_itnim_s

19 static void bfa_itnim_update_del_itn_stats(struct bfa_itnim_s *itnim);
108 static void bfa_itnim_iocdisable_cleanup(struct bfa_itnim_s *itnim);
109 static bfa_boolean_t bfa_itnim_send_fwcreate(struct bfa_itnim_s *itnim);
110 static bfa_boolean_t bfa_itnim_send_fwdelete(struct bfa_itnim_s *itnim);
112 static void bfa_itnim_cleanup(struct bfa_itnim_s *itnim);
116 static void bfa_itnim_iotov_online(struct bfa_itnim_s *itnim);
117 static void bfa_itnim_iotov_cleanup(struct bfa_itnim_s *itnim);
119 static void bfa_itnim_iotov_start(struct bfa_itnim_s *itnim);
120 static void bfa_itnim_iotov_stop(struct bfa_itnim_s *itnim);
121 static void bfa_itnim_iotov_delete(struct bfa_itnim_s *itnim);
126 static void bfa_itnim_sm_uninit(struct bfa_itnim_s *itnim,
128 static void bfa_itnim_sm_created(struct bfa_itnim_s *itnim,
130 static void bfa_itnim_sm_fwcreate(struct bfa_itnim_s *itnim,
132 static void bfa_itnim_sm_delete_pending(struct bfa_itnim_s *itnim,
134 static void bfa_itnim_sm_online(struct bfa_itnim_s *itnim,
136 static void bfa_itnim_sm_sler(struct bfa_itnim_s *itnim,
138 static void bfa_itnim_sm_cleanup_offline(struct bfa_itnim_s *itnim,
140 static void bfa_itnim_sm_cleanup_delete(struct bfa_itnim_s *itnim,
142 static void bfa_itnim_sm_fwdelete(struct bfa_itnim_s *itnim,
144 static void bfa_itnim_sm_offline(struct bfa_itnim_s *itnim,
146 static void bfa_itnim_sm_iocdisable(struct bfa_itnim_s *itnim,
148 static void bfa_itnim_sm_deleting(struct bfa_itnim_s *itnim,
150 static void bfa_itnim_sm_fwcreate_qfull(struct bfa_itnim_s *itnim,
152 static void bfa_itnim_sm_fwdelete_qfull(struct bfa_itnim_s *itnim,
154 static void bfa_itnim_sm_deleting_qfull(struct bfa_itnim_s *itnim,
286 struct bfa_itnim_s *itnim; in bfa_fcpim_iocdisable()
293 itnim = (struct bfa_itnim_s *) qe; in bfa_fcpim_iocdisable()
375 struct bfa_itnim_s *itnim; in bfa_fcpim_port_iostats()
380 itnim = (struct bfa_itnim_s *) qe; in bfa_fcpim_port_iostats()
414 struct bfa_itnim_s *itnim; in bfa_fcpim_profile_on()
420 itnim = (struct bfa_itnim_s *) qe; in bfa_fcpim_profile_on()
457 bfa_itnim_sm_uninit(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_uninit()
478 bfa_itnim_sm_created(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_created()
509 bfa_itnim_sm_fwcreate(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_fwcreate()
543 bfa_itnim_sm_fwcreate_qfull(struct bfa_itnim_s *itnim, in bfa_itnim_sm_fwcreate_qfull()
581 bfa_itnim_sm_delete_pending(struct bfa_itnim_s *itnim, in bfa_itnim_sm_delete_pending()
609 bfa_itnim_sm_online(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_online()
651 bfa_itnim_sm_sler(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_sler()
682 bfa_itnim_sm_cleanup_offline(struct bfa_itnim_s *itnim, in bfa_itnim_sm_cleanup_offline()
719 bfa_itnim_sm_cleanup_delete(struct bfa_itnim_s *itnim, in bfa_itnim_sm_cleanup_delete()
747 bfa_itnim_sm_fwdelete(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_fwdelete()
773 bfa_itnim_sm_fwdelete_qfull(struct bfa_itnim_s *itnim, in bfa_itnim_sm_fwdelete_qfull()
804 bfa_itnim_sm_offline(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_offline()
833 bfa_itnim_sm_iocdisable(struct bfa_itnim_s *itnim, in bfa_itnim_sm_iocdisable()
869 bfa_itnim_sm_deleting(struct bfa_itnim_s *itnim, enum bfa_itnim_event event) in bfa_itnim_sm_deleting()
887 bfa_itnim_sm_deleting_qfull(struct bfa_itnim_s *itnim, in bfa_itnim_sm_deleting_qfull()
914 bfa_itnim_iocdisable_cleanup(struct bfa_itnim_s *itnim) in bfa_itnim_iocdisable_cleanup()
950 struct bfa_itnim_s *itnim = itnim_cbarg; in bfa_itnim_cleanp_comp()
960 bfa_itnim_cleanup(struct bfa_itnim_s *itnim) in bfa_itnim_cleanup()
994 struct bfa_itnim_s *itnim = cbarg; in __bfa_cb_itnim_online()
1003 struct bfa_itnim_s *itnim = cbarg; in __bfa_cb_itnim_offline()
1012 struct bfa_itnim_s *itnim = cbarg; in __bfa_cb_itnim_sler()
1024 struct bfa_itnim_s *itnim = cbarg; in bfa_itnim_qresume()
1034 bfa_itnim_iodone(struct bfa_itnim_s *itnim) in bfa_itnim_iodone()
1040 bfa_itnim_tskdone(struct bfa_itnim_s *itnim) in bfa_itnim_tskdone()
1051 *km_len += cfg->fwcfg.num_rports * sizeof(struct bfa_itnim_s); in bfa_itnim_meminfo()
1059 struct bfa_itnim_s *itnim; in bfa_itnim_attach()
1064 itnim = (struct bfa_itnim_s *) bfa_mem_kva_curp(fcp); in bfa_itnim_attach()
1068 memset(itnim, 0, sizeof(struct bfa_itnim_s)); in bfa_itnim_attach()
1090 bfa_itnim_iocdisable(struct bfa_itnim_s *itnim) in bfa_itnim_iocdisable()
1097 bfa_itnim_send_fwcreate(struct bfa_itnim_s *itnim) in bfa_itnim_send_fwcreate()
1128 bfa_itnim_send_fwdelete(struct bfa_itnim_s *itnim) in bfa_itnim_send_fwdelete()
1157 bfa_itnim_delayed_comp(struct bfa_itnim_s *itnim, bfa_boolean_t iotov) in bfa_itnim_delayed_comp()
1172 bfa_itnim_iotov_online(struct bfa_itnim_s *itnim) in bfa_itnim_iotov_online()
1197 bfa_itnim_iotov_cleanup(struct bfa_itnim_s *itnim) in bfa_itnim_iotov_cleanup()
1222 struct bfa_itnim_s *itnim = itnim_arg; in bfa_itnim_iotov()
1235 bfa_itnim_iotov_start(struct bfa_itnim_s *itnim) in bfa_itnim_iotov_start()
1250 bfa_itnim_iotov_stop(struct bfa_itnim_s *itnim) in bfa_itnim_iotov_stop()
1262 bfa_itnim_iotov_delete(struct bfa_itnim_s *itnim) in bfa_itnim_iotov_delete()
1278 bfa_itnim_update_del_itn_stats(struct bfa_itnim_s *itnim) in bfa_itnim_update_del_itn_stats()
1308 struct bfa_itnim_s *itnim; in bfa_itnim_isr()
1348 struct bfa_itnim_s *
1352 struct bfa_itnim_s *itnim; in bfa_itnim_create()
1368 bfa_itnim_delete(struct bfa_itnim_s *itnim) in bfa_itnim_delete()
1375 bfa_itnim_online(struct bfa_itnim_s *itnim, bfa_boolean_t seq_rec) in bfa_itnim_online()
1383 bfa_itnim_offline(struct bfa_itnim_s *itnim) in bfa_itnim_offline()
1394 bfa_itnim_hold_io(struct bfa_itnim_s *itnim) in bfa_itnim_hold_io()
1408 bfa_itnim_get_ioprofile(struct bfa_itnim_s *itnim, in bfa_itnim_get_ioprofile()
1433 bfa_itnim_clear_stats(struct bfa_itnim_s *itnim) in bfa_itnim_clear_stats()
2394 struct bfa_itnim_s *itnim = ioim->itnim; in bfa_ioim_send_ioreq()
2880 struct bfa_itnim_s *itnim, u16 nsges) in bfa_ioim_alloc()
3254 struct bfa_itnim_s *itnim = tskim->itnim; in bfa_tskim_gather_ios()
3328 struct bfa_itnim_s *itnim = tskim->itnim; in bfa_tskim_send()
3363 struct bfa_itnim_s *itnim = tskim->itnim; in bfa_tskim_send_abort()
3544 bfa_tskim_start(struct bfa_tskim_s *tskim, struct bfa_itnim_s *itnim, in bfa_tskim_start()